Bihar Minority Residential School

The Bihar Minority Residential Schools, established under Bihar State Minority Awasiya Vidyalaya Yojna, aimed to provide free, quality residential education to students from Minority Communities (Muslim, Shikh, Christian, Parsi, Jain and Bodh) across Bihar. These residential schools are designed to fulfill the holistic development of students from Class 9 to Class 12.

Key Features

  • Free Education and Facilities: Students get free education, accommodation, meals , medical care and books.
  • Curriculum: Bihar Minority Residential School offers classes from 9th, 10th, 11th and 12th. For class 12th, it provides mainly two streams PCB (Physics, Chemistry and Biology) and PCM (Physics, Chemistry and Math).

Reservation Policy

In Bihar Minority Residential School, 50% of the seats are reserved for girls, and 75% of the seats are reserved for rural students for both boys and girls.

Eligibility Criteria For Admission

  • Resident of Bihar: Candidates must be the resident of Bihar and belong to the minority communities (Muslim, Shikh, Isai, Parsi, Jain and Bodh).
  • Age Limit: The maximum age limit for class 9th is 16 years and 18 years for class 11th admission.
  • Annual Income: The annual family income should not exceed 600000.00 (six lac).

Admission Process

Admission in Minority Residential School for Kishanganj and Darbhanga is based on an entrance exam. The entrance exam is held by the Minority Department. Admission entrance exam is taken for 9th and 11th.
